First off, let’s revisit how to get into customization heaven. As you might have seen, just press and hold your Home Screen until those app icons start to 'jiggle.' Once they do, you'll often see options like 'Customize' or 'Edit' appear. This is your gateway! Tapping 'Customize' opens up a world of possibilities. You can change your wallpaper, add widgets, and crucially, adjust your Home Screen's overall appearance. One of the coolest features I found is right there under 'Appearance.' You’ll see choices like 'Light,' 'Dark,' and 'Automatic.' 'Automatic' is a game-changer because it switches between light and dark themes based on the time of day – perfect for saving your eyes at night without having to manually change it. For instance, it can automatically activate dark mode at sunset and switch back to light mode at sunrise. And sometimes there's even a 'Tinted' option that subtly colors your wallpaper for a more cohesive look, really making your Home Screen feel polished. But wait, there's more to optimizing your dark mode! Did you know you can schedule dark mode to come on and off automatically? Head into your iPhone's 'Settings' app, then 'Display & Brightness.' Here, you’ll find the 'Dark' option. Make sure 'Automatic' is toggled on, and you can even set a custom schedule, like from 9 PM to 7 AM, or 'Sunset to Sunrise.' It's a lifesaver for consistent visual comfort throughout your day! Another pro tip: not all apps automatically follow your system-wide dark mode settings. Some apps have their own independent dark mode. For example, many social media apps or productivity tools have a dedicated dark mode setting within their own app menus. If an app isn't going dark when your system is, check its individual settings! This ensures a consistent dark experience across all your frequently used applications. Beyond just looking cool, dark mode offers real benefits. For iPhones with OLED screens (like iPhone X and newer), dark mode can actually save a bit of battery life because black pixels are essentially turned off. Plus, for many, it significantly reduces eye strain, especially when scrolling in low-light environments. I personally find it much more comfortable for late-night browsing or reading.
